We are the Sector Council for Health and Community Care Workforce in Nova Scotia. Our mandate is to provide human resources knowledge, expertise, programs to best serve the healthcare and person support workforce.

We provide training for the following core programs: Mental Health First Aid (MHFA), The Working Mind (TWM), Non-Violent Crisis Intervention (NVCI), Gentle Persuasive Approach (GPA), Diversity, Inclusion and Belonging training, (Pilot) Certificate in Inclusive Leadership (CIL), Contagious Resiliency Leadership (CRL), (Pilot) Psychological Safety Assessments (in partnership with Opening Minds/Mental Health Commission of Canada), (Pilot) Workforce Training (education) Consultant services (In partnership with WIPSI), Labor Market Data services, RN/LPN Long-Term Care Orientation program (with preceptor/mentorship), Supportive Palliative Approach to Long Term Care Program (SPA-LTC) in partnership with McMaster University and Pallum.
